Inquiry follows security concerns over reported visits of dozens of women to Bruno Foucher’s official residence France has opened disciplinary proceedings against its ambassador to Central African Republic over allegations of misconduct, after claims that he brought dozens of women into his official residence, raising potential security concerns.

The investigation comes as Paris seeks to rebuild relations with CAR, after their sharp deterioration in recent years amid Russia’s expanding influence in the former French colony. Continue reading...
